Frequently Asked Questions about Ruffin

What type of rentals are currently available in Ruffin?

There are currently 44 Apartments for Rent in Ruffin, NC with pricing that ranges from $695 to $6,928.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Ruffin ranging from $575 to $3,200.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Ruffin?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Ruffin ranges from $575 to $3,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,500.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Ruffin?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Ruffin range from $1,070 to $6,429,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$750 to $2,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,149 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$775.
